Originally Posted by wuk
Picked up a CPO 2013 a6 in April and finally got around to contacting Sirius to get a free trial (figured I could ask for one as I never have had an account before). I asked for a 6 month free trial, person came back saying I was all setup for a 48 month trial. Did I miss something? 48 > 6 correct? Sounds too good to be true. Happy as long as this is legit. Used online chat on their website. Hope this helps someone!
Audi includes free Sirius Traffic only for 48 months, not radio. The free trial for Sirius radio is 3 months. And T-Mobile Audi Connect free trial is for 6 months. All of these are for new car purchases only unless the previous owner on a used car did not cancel or transfer to another car.
